Q. Show Leak Area Preparation?

Clearly mark the location of the leak on the flange with a permanent marker.

Notes: 1. Depressurizing hydrocarbon lines in non-emergency events is not desirable.

For high temperature service refer to ASME B16.5 for maximum allowable pressures.

The leak repair procedure can be implemented provided the following conditions are met:

Leak rates are considered manageable and environmental conditions in the proximity of the leak allow safe maintenance operations.

Every attempt to eliminate ignition sources has been made.

Non-sparking tools shall be used in cases of hydrocarbon leaks.

A qualified process supervisor, safety person, maintenance supervisor, and design engineer have reviewed and approved the work.

The leaking flange does not have a ring joint gasket.
